网页接口报405是什么问题?
admin
26
2024-07-05
405错误是什么问题?当我们在浏览网页时,有时会遇到一些错误页面,其中之一就是405错误。这个错误通常出现在我们执行一个不被支持的HTTP方法时,比如在一个只允许GET和POST请求的接口中使用PUT或DELETE方法。什么是HTTP方
405错误是什么问题?
当我们在浏览网页时,有时会遇到一些错误页面,其中之一就是405错误。这个错误通常出现在我们执行一个不被支持的HTTP方法时,比如在一个只允许GET和POST请求的接口中使用PUT或DELETE方法。
什么是HTTP方法?
HTTP方法是HTTP协议中定义的动作,用于指定对资源的操作类型。常见的HTTP方法有GET、POST、PUT、DELETE等。其中GET用于获取资源,POST用于创建资源,PUT用于更新资源,DELETE用于删除资源。
在RESTful API中,通常会根据资源的类型和操作,来决定使用哪种HTTP方法。
为什么会出现405错误?
405错误通常是由服务器端设置了不允许的HTTP方法导致的。这可能是为了安全考虑,防止未授权的访问或对资源的误操作。如果客户端尝试使用不被支持的HTTP方法,服务器就会返回405错误提示。
如何解决405错误?
- 检查请求方法:首先要确认您所使用的HTTP方法是否与服务器允许的方法一致,可以查看接口文档或联系接口提供者。
- 使用正确的HTTP方法:如果发现错误,需要修改请求中的HTTP方法,保证与服务器允许的方法匹配。
- 修改权限设置:如果您是接口提供者,需要检查服务器端的权限设置,确保允许客户端使用相应的HTTP方法。
- 联系接口提供者:如果无法解决,可以联系接口提供者寻求帮助,他们可能会告知您正确的HTTP方法或调整服务器配置。
在日常开发中,遇到405错误并不罕见,但通过仔细检查和正确操作,我们往往能够迅速解决这个问题,保证接口正常运行。
总结
在网络通信过程中,HTTP方法是非常重要的部分,合理使用HTTP方法可以更好地进行资源的管理和操作。当遇到405错误时,不必过分紧张,只需要仔细排查问题,逐步解决,问题往往可以迎刃而解。